Jhipster Registry (Eureka server) docker two-way Unicom and high availability deployment

Use compose to orchestrate this Eureka server cluster:

Peer1 configuration:

server:
    port: 8761

eureka:
    instance:
        hostname: eureka-peer-1
    server:
        # see discussion about enable-self-preservation:
        # https://github.com/jhipster/generator-jhipster/issues/3654
        enable-self-preservation: false
        registry-sync-retry-wait-ms: 500
        a-sgcache-expiry-timeout-ms: 60000
        eviction-interval-timer-in-ms: 30000
        peer-eureka-nodes-update-interval-ms: 30000
        renewal-threshold-update-interval-ms: 15000
    client:
        fetch-registry: true
        register-with-eureka: true
        service-url:
            defaultZone: http://admin:${spring.security.user.password:admin}@eureka-peer-2:8762/eureka/

Peer2 configuration:

server:
    port: 8762

eureka:
    instance:
        hostname: eureka-peer-2
    server:
        # see discussion about enable-self-preservation:
        # https://github.com/jhipster/generator-jhipster/issues/3654
        enable-self-preservation: false
        registry-sync-retry-wait-ms: 500
        a-sgcache-expiry-timeout-ms: 60000
        eviction-interval-timer-in-ms: 30000
        peer-eureka-nodes-update-interval-ms: 30000
        renewal-threshold-update-interval-ms: 15000
    client:
        fetch-registry: true
        register-with-eureka: true
        service-url:
            defaultZone: http://admin:${spring.security.user.password:admin}@eureka-peer-1:8761/eureka/

Build image

Use the official dockerfile:

FROM openjdk:8-jre-alpine

ENV SPRING_OUTPUT_ANSI_ENABLED=ALWAYS \
    JAVA_OPTS="" \
    JHIPSTER_SLEEP=0

VOLUME /tmp
EXPOSE 8761
CMD echo "The application will start in ${JHIPSTER_SLEEP}s..." && \
    sleep ${JHIPSTER_SLEEP} && \
    java ${JAVA_OPTS} -Djava.security.egd=file:/dev/./urandom -jar /app.war

# add directly the war
ADD *.war /app.war

Build the image and push it to the registry. Here is 192.168 86.8:5000/registry-dev
